Citation XLS First Officer - Part 135 Operations
A leading Part 135 aviation company is seeking a professional and motivated Citation XLS First Officer to join their team. This position is based at Dallas Love Field (DAL) and offers a competitive compensation package, structured career development, and a defined pathway towards Captain roles and opportunities within the Gulfstream fleet.
Responsibilities
- Operate as a Citation XLS First Officer, supporting the Captain and flight operations team.
- Assist in the safe and efficient operation of Part 135 charter flights.
- Support all phases of flight planning, performance calculations, and operational documentation.
- Complete all required training, checking, and company-mandated qualifications.
- Deliver exceptional customer service and maintain a professional presence with passengers.
- Uphold strong Crew Resource Management (CRM) principles and contribute to a positive, safety-focused cockpit culture.
- Support the Captain in all operational and regulatory requirements.
Mandatory Requirements
- Minimum 1,500 hours Total Flight Time.
- Valid First Class Medical Certificate.
- Commercial Multi-Engine Pilot Certificate (ATP written examination preferred).
- Demonstrated strong turbine and multi-engine experience.
- Valid U.S. work authorization.
- Must reside in or be able to reliably commute from the Dallas metropolitan area.
- Willingness to commit to a 12-month training agreement.
